Environmental Epidemiology

Assessment of the health impact associated with exposure to environmental risk factors

Course description

Using real case studies as examples, this course aims to assess the health effects of various environmental exposures through the design of specific studies.

It applies epidemiology skills to assess the health effects of common environmental exposures, such as secondhand tobacco smoke or radon, or natural disasters including volcanic eruptions, or other environmental accidents for example oil spills or chemical contamination.
